Choosing the Right Flowers for Your Story
Each type of flower carries its own symbolism and meaning, making it important to choose the right blooms for your visual storytelling. For example, roses are often associated with love and passion, while daisies symbolize innocence and purity. Consider the emotional tone and message of your story when selecting flowers. Orchids, for instance, convey elegance and refinement, making them ideal for more sophisticated and upscale content. By matching the flower choices to the themes and emotions you want to communicate, you can create a cohesive and impactful visual story.
